Transaction 104eddc151a90b6bd668910300b2e7837a38fa85d1337580cee7ed4285de6949
1 Input
1 Output
-
104eddc151a90b6bd668910300b2e7837a38fa85d1337580cee7ed4285de6949:0
- value
- 72958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4149c4f8d224dc5e750bf513a9ac631afde88fb1 OP_EQUAL
- address
- 37eEDbsQo537UViUbBsrqG7ACR9TSAF62L